Gardeners’ World 2025 – Episode 2
As spring surges forwards at Longmeadow, Monty makes the most of the longer days as he continues the rejuvenation of his Jewel Garden borders. Now is a great time to get shrubs in the ground, and dramatic dark- flowered hydrangeas take centre stage. He also makes a start on sowing some of his favourite flowers and harvests his first fresh stalks of rhubarb.
Joe Swift meets a group of neighbours championing their front gardens by showcasing an amazing variety of plants and building community spirit. And Sue Kent is in Carmarthenshire, comparing notes with a fellow veg grower who has learnt how to harness the Welsh weather to grow an impressive array of tasty produce.
There’s a doctor in Edinburgh who explains how ripping up her lawn transformed her back garden into a beautiful oasis. And in Somerset, the gates are thrown open to the only Grade 1 listed cottage garden in the country, whose gardener has been preserving its horticultural heritage.
